Five HKU Scholars Ranked First in Asia by Discipline by Research.com
Twelve HKU distinguished scholars have been named by the international academic website Research.com among the top 100 scholars globally in their respective disciplines in 2025. Among them, five professors have been ranked first in Asia in their disciplines.

Young scientists from HKU have excelled in the 2025 National Natural Science Foundation of China (NSFC) funding exercise, securing the highest number of grants among all Hong Kong institutions in both the Young Scientist Fund (Type A) and (Type B) categories.

Professor Chao Xiang, Assistant Professor of HKU's Department of Electrical and Electronic Engineering, has been honoured with the 2025 Croucher Tak Wah Mak Innovation Award for his pioneering research in silicon photonics, specifically his work on “integrating lasers for advanced photonic integrated circuits".
